What has reverted in Tatkal ticket booking?
Railways has implemented a new token system for passengers taking Tatkal tickets at reservation counters. Now the tokens will be issued at the same time when the Tatkal ticket booking process starts. Its objective is to reduce long queues and tenancy crowding at the counter. Under the new system, tokens will be given from 8:30 to 9:00 am for AC Tatkal tickets and from 9:00 to 9:30 am for non-AC tickets.
After this, the concerned passengers will be worldly-wise to typesetting tickets on the understructure of their token. Railways believes that this will save time for passengers and make the booking process increasingly organised. This transpiration has currently been implemented at the reservation counters of West Central Railway.
Now how much penalty will have to be paid for late filing of ITR?
The deadline for filing income tax returns has expired for those taxpayers whose finance were not required to be audited. Now, for filing returns, you may have to pay late fees ranging from Rs 1,000 to Rs 5,000 depending on the income. However, there is still time left for many taxpayers involved in business. The due stage for ITR-3 and ITR-4 (unaudited cases) is August 31, 2026, while for audited cases, the deadline is October 31, 2026.
How much relief has been given in the price of commercial gas cylinders?
Like the first of every month, this time too oil marketing companies have released new prices of LPG. The price of 19 kg commercial LPG cylinder has been reduced by Rs 202 in Delhi. This is expected to provide relief to hotels, restaurants, dhabas and small businessmen. There has been no transpiration in the prices of 14.2 kg domestic LPG cylinder this time. How will customers goody from the implementation of CKYC 2.0?
The CKYC 2.0 system is moreover stuff implemented for banks, insurance companies and bilateral fund institutions from August 1. Its objective is to make KYC records of customers misogynist on a worldwide digital platform, thereby reducing the need for repeated submission of documents at variegated financial institutions.
With this system, the process of availing new financial services is expected to be faster and easier than before.
